9th Grade AP English (AP English Language and Composition or AP English Literature and Composition, depending on your school) focuses on developing critical reading, writing, and analytical skills. Students learn to analyze rhetorical strategies, construct evidence-based arguments, write in multiple styles, and interpret complex texts—skills that prepare them for both the AP exam and college-level coursework. The curriculum emphasizes close reading, essay writing, and understanding how authors use language to create meaning.
Many 9th graders struggle with the transition from standard English classes to AP-level rigor, particularly with analyzing complex texts and writing timed essays under pressure. Common challenges include understanding rhetorical devices and their purpose, organizing arguments clearly within essay time limits, and developing a strong thesis statement. Additionally, students often find it difficult to balance close reading with the broader context of a work, and managing test anxiety during the AP exam itself.

Score improvement depends on your starting point, effort level, and how consistently you work with a tutor. Students who engage actively in tutoring sessions and complete practice assignments typically see meaningful gains—often 1-2 points on the AP scale (which ranges from 1-5). The most significant improvements come from understanding question formats, practicing timed essays regularly, and receiving detailed feedback on your writing that you can apply to future work.
Your first session is an opportunity for a tutor to understand your current level, learning style, and specific goals. You'll likely discuss which AP English course you're taking, review a writing sample or discuss a recent assignment, and identify your main areas for improvement. From there, the tutor will create a personalized plan focused on building skills in essay writing, reading comprehension, or test strategy—whatever will have the biggest impact on your success.
Most students benefit from 1-2 tutoring sessions per week combined with independent practice between sessions. If you're preparing for the AP exam, starting tutoring 3-4 months before the test date gives you solid time to build skills and work through practice materials. The key is consistency—regular, focused practice with feedback is more effective than cramming, and your tutor can help you develop a realistic study schedule that fits your other coursework.

Look for tutors with strong backgrounds in English literature, composition, and ideally experience teaching or tutoring AP-level courses. They should understand the AP exam format, scoring rubrics, and common student mistakes. Beyond credentials, the best tutors are skilled at explaining complex concepts clearly, providing constructive feedback on writing, and adapting their teaching style to help you learn effectively.
